EFCC drags Senator Okorocha to court over 2.9-billion-naira fraud

The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ission has slammed seventeen count charge of fraud against Senator Rochas Okorocha.

The EFCC alleged that Senator Okorocha and six others, including five companies, stole two point nine billion naira belonging to the people of Imo State.

The anti-graft agency claimed that Senator Okorocha and the companies committed the crime between October 2014 and February 2016.

The money was allegedly taken from the Imo State Government House account and the Imo State Joint Local Government Project account.

Aside the five companies, the other suspects named in the case is Anyim Nyerere Chinenye.
